Major Takedown of Child Abusers in Texas: Operation Soteria Shield
In a significant law enforcement initiative, the FBI’s Dallas division has successfully executed a large-scale operation aimed at tackling child exploitation and abuse in Texas. This operation, known as Operation Soteria Shield, has led to the rescue of 109 children and the arrest of nearly 250 offenders. With almost 400 charges filed at both federal and state levels, the operation highlights the ongoing commitment of law enforcement agencies to combat child exploitation across the United States.
Overview of Operation Soteria Shield
Operation Soteria Shield was designed as a comprehensive effort involving over 70 federal, state, and local law enforcement partners. The operation’s name, "Soteria," derives from the Greek word for "salvation," which aptly reflects its goal—to save vulnerable children from the grasp of abusers and traffickers.
